Application Ruthenium(III) chloride serves as a versatile and essential reagent in various chemical applications due to its role as a starting material for ruthenium complexes. It is primarily utilized for its catalytic capabilities in several reactions, such as the oxidative cyclization of 1,7-dienes to produce oxepane diols and the hydroxylation of tertiary hydrocarbons when combined with periodate or bromate. The compound is also crucial in the synthesis of labeled variants of 2,3-pyridinedicarboxylic acid, acting as a catalyst in complex synthesis processes. Its ability to exhibit a wide range of oxidation states makes it highly valuable for oxidation-reduction reactions in chemical analysis, including testing for sulfur trioxide. Although highly toxic, ruthenium(III) chloride, particularly in its trihydrate form, demonstrates wide application as a soluble catalyst in numerous solvents, providing a stable yet chemically flexible medium for experiments and synthesis.
